Do guests need to download an app?
No. Guests can scan a QR code or use a website chat entry point. This is important for hotels because short-stay guests rarely want to install another app.
Can GSM support international guests?
Yes. GSM is designed for multilingual guest communication so guests can ask questions in their own language while staff receive structured context.

Is GSM only a chatbot?
No. GSM is built for hotel operations. The assistant can answer questions, but also turns service needs into structured staff tasks and request records.
Can staff take over conversations?
Yes. Human takeover is available in operational packages, and live translation support can help teams handle guests across languages.
Does GSM replace hotel staff?
No. GSM helps staff reduce repetitive questions, capture requests more clearly, and prioritize work. It is designed to support operations, not remove the human service layer.

Can GSM start as a pilot?
Yes. A pilot can start with selected rooms, one property, or a specific workflow before expanding to more departments or properties.
What should a hotel prepare before a demo?
The most useful inputs are common guest questions, current request handling workflow, team structure, language needs, and the main operational bottlenecks.
